2. Mark’s Garden

Mark’s Garden remains one of the best-known names in high-end event floristry. Its work tends to feel polished, composed, and visually commanding. If you are planning a formal wedding or a high-visibility event, that kind of control can be a real strength.

This is less of a casual everyday florist and more of an event-first studio with retail capability. That distinction matters. When flowers need scale, proportion, and clean installation, event experience matters as much as taste.

Mark’s Garden is a good fit for clients who want classic luxury and strong production capacity. It is less ideal if you prefer loose, airy floral design or want a relaxed neighborhood-shop feel.

  • Best for: luxury weddings and large-format events
  • Strength: strong event execution and formal floral styling
  • Trade-off: more consultation-heavy for custom work

3. Empty Vase

Empty Vase has long been known for dramatic floral work with a glossy, architectural feel. The style is bold and intentional. If you want a luxury arrangement that reads across the room, this shop does that well.

It is also useful for shorter timelines. Same-day options, pickup, and bespoke ordering make it practical for buyers who need something fast but still premium. Just note that the look is more controlled and statement-driven than soft and garden-like.

One practical question helps here. Ask whether the arrangement is designed front-facing or all around, especially if it is going on a dining table. That simple detail can change whether the floral piece feels perfect for the room.

  • Best for: last-minute luxury gifting and statement arrangements
  • Strength: fast access to high-impact floral design
  • Trade-off: premium pricing and a more formal design style

4. Native Poppy

Native Poppy brings a softer, more relaxed Southern California look. The floral style feels seasonal, bright, and approachable. This is a strong pick for birthdays, smaller weddings, dinner-party gifts, and clients who want good taste without a heavy consultation process.

The shop also makes repeat buying easier through workshops, a-la-carte wedding options, and recurring flowers. That flexibility is part of the appeal. You can order something beautiful without feeling pushed into a large custom project.

Its limitation is reach. Native Poppy is best thought of as a regional florist, not a statewide solution. For San Diego County clients, though, that local focus is exactly what makes it useful.

  • Best for: seasonal gifting, casual weddings, and recurring local orders
  • Strength: approachable floral style and easy ordering
  • Trade-off: regional service area

How to choose the right California florist

Start with the occasion, then the operating model. A wedding, a same-day apology bouquet, and weekly reception flowers should not be bought the same way. Before you fall for style, check delivery range, cutoff times, consultation needs, and whether the florist is built for one-off orders or ongoing floral service.

If speed matters, look for clear timing and realistic coverage. If the flowers are for an event, ask about installation and cleanup. If the order is recurring, ask how the florist keeps the work from feeling repetitive over time. Ask how the florist designs for your specific space, how often deliveries happen, whether vessels are part of the service, and how they keep arrangements from feeling repetitive. Boutique studios often do this better because they pay closer attention to scale, palette, and how the room is actually used.
The difference is usually the design model. Catalog-first florists focus on repeatable products and broad convenience. Designer-led studios work more seasonally and shape the arrangement around the occasion, the room, or the recipient. That is why shops like Fiore, Ampersand, and Bloom & Plume feel more distinctive.
